The Rotax MAX Jetting App enables the user to calculate the optimal carburetor main jet size for Rotax kart engines of the MAX series:
- 125 Micro MAX evo
- 125 Mini MAX evo
- 125 Junior MAX evo
- 125 Senior MAX evo
- 125 MAX DD2
based on the current ambient conditions
- Temperature
- Altitude
- Air pressure 
- Humidity
This can be done either automatically using GPS and a functioning internet connection or manually by entering the ambient parameters.
*Automatically*
Click on Use GPS position for weather data, select the desired engine type from the scroll menu and start the calculation tabbing the Calculate button.
*Manually*
Enter all ambient parameters, select the desired engine type from the scroll menu and start the calculation tabbing the Calculate button.
Important: Since the calculation is based on the "relative air pressure" (air pressure at 0m above sea level), your own barometer must be calibrated to the current altitude before you can actually use the value. Online weather services provide this value by default.
To toggle between Celsius and Fahrenheit, press °C/°F and to choose between meters and feet press m/ft next to the entry of the value.
To start a new calculation, click Reset.
